Why Starting Words Matter in Wordle

Every guess in Wordle reveals valuable clues: green letters highlight correct letters in the right position, yellow indicates correct letters in the wrong spot, and gray means they aren’t in the word. By picking strategic opening words, you maximize exposure of letters and properties early — setting the stage for rapid progression.

Pro Tips for Using Wordle Start Words Strategically

  • Balance vowels and consonants: Avoid overly rare letters like Q or Z in early guesses. Focus on common ones like A, E, R, S, T, N, I.
  • Analyze feedback promptly: Always adjust your next word based on letter colors and positions — don’t repeat futile guesses.
  • Keep a log: Track which start words and follow-ups consistently win for you, building a personalized Wordle strategy.
  • Practice smart: The more you use these top start words, the faster you’ll develop intuition for optimal letter combinations.
